Three best signings by RCB in IPL history
3. AB de Villiers (2011-2021)

AB de Villiers, the South African batting maestro, joined RCB in 2011 and quickly became an integral part of the team’s batting lineup. During his 11-year stint with the franchise, de Villiers amassed 4,491 runs in 156 matches, making him the second-highest run-scorer for RCB.
He also holds the record for the highest individual partnership for RCB, scoring 229 runs with Virat Kohli against Gujarat Lions in 2016.
De Villiers’ impact on RCB was not limited to his batting prowess. His presence in the team provided stability and confidence to the other batters, and his ability to play match-winning innings under pressure was unparalleled. He was a key player in RCB’s run to the IPL final in 2016, where they finished as runners-up.
2. Chris Gayle (2011-2017)

Chris Gayle, the West Indian opener, joined RCB in 2011 and quickly established himself as one of the most destructive batters in the league. During his seven-year stint with the franchise, Gayle scored 3,163 runs in 85 matches, making him the fifth-highest run-scorer for RCB.
He also holds the record for the highest individual partnership for RCB, scoring 204 runs with Tillakaratne Dilshan against Delhi Daredevils in 2012.
Gayle’s impact on RCB was not limited to his batting prowess. His ability to provide explosive starts at the top of the order set the tone for the team’s innings, and his presence in the team boosted the morale of the other players. He was a key player in RCB’s run to the IPL final in 2011, where they finished as runners-up.
1. Virat Kohli (2008- Present)

Virat Kohli, the Indian batting sensation, joined RCB in 2008 and has been with the franchise ever since. During his 17-year stint with the team, Kohli has amassed 6,624 runs in 251 matches, making him the highest run-scorer for RCB and the highest run-scorer in IPL history.
He also holds the record for the highest individual partnership for RCB, scoring 181 runs with Devdutt Padikkal against Rajasthan Royals in 2021.
Kohli’s impact on RCB has been immense. He has been the backbone of the team’s batting lineup for over a decade and has led the team as captain from 2013 to 2021.
Under his captaincy, RCB reached the IPL final in 2016, where they finished as runners-up. Kohli’s dedication, passion, and leadership have been instrumental in shaping RCB’s identity as a team that plays aggressive and entertaining cricket.
